A Randomized, Double-Blind, Placebo-Controlled, Parallel-Group, 6-Week Clinical Study to Assess the Effect of Inhaled Aclidinium Bromide (LAS34273) 200 ug on Exercise Endurance and Lung Hyperinflation in Patients With Moderate to Severe COPD

研究概览
简要总结
This study evaluated the effect of inhaled aclidinium bromide on exercise endurance and in reducing resting and dynamic lung hyperinflation in patients with moderate to severe COPD. It was 9 weeks in duration, consisting of; a 2-week run-in period, 6 weeks of double-blind treatment, and a 1-week follow-up phone call. All patients meeting the eligibility criteria were randomized to one of two treatment groups: aclidinium bromide or placebo.

入选标准
- •A diagnosis of stable moderate to severe COPD (GOLD 2006); post-levalbuterol FEV1 >=30% and < 80% predicted and FEV1/FVC<70% predicted
- •Current or former cigarette smoker
- •Functional Residual Capacity (FRC) measured by body plethysmography >= 120% of predicted value
- •Baseline Dyspnea Index (BDI) focal score ≤ 7 at Visit 4
排除标准
- •History of presence of asthma, allergic rhinitis, or atopy
- •Hospitalization for acute COPD exacerbation in the 3 months prior to study entry
- •Respiratory tract infection (including the upper respiratory tract) or COPD exacerbation in the 6 weeks prior to study entry
- •Clinically significant respiratory conditions other than COPD
- •Chronic use of oxygen therapy >= 15 hours a day

结局指标
主要结局
Change From Baseline in Exercise Endurance Time (ET)
时间窗: From baseline Week 0 (Visit 4) to Week 6 (Visit 6)
Exercise endurance time is defined as the time from the increase in work rate at 75% Wmax (watts) to the point of symptom limitation. The Wmax is defined as the highest work rate the patients were able to maintain for at least 30 seconds.
次要结局
- Trough Forced Expiratory Volume in 1 Second (FEV1)(Change from baseline (Visit 4) at Week 6 (Visit 6))
- Trough Inspiratory Capacity (IC)(Change from baseline Week 0 (Visit 4) to Week 6 (Visit 6))
- Functional Residual Capacity (FRC)(Change from baseline Week 0 (Visit 4) to Week 6 (Visit 6))
- Inspiratory Capacity (IC)/Total Lung Capacity (TLC) Ratio(Change from baseline Week 0 (Visit 4) to Week 6 (Visit 6))
